Mrs. Anne E. Dupont, age 99, of Castle Road, Newport passed away peacefully on Monday morning, February 17, 2025, at Alpine Nursing and Rehab, Little Falls.
She was born on March 28, 1925, in Remsen, NY daughter of the late John and Katherine (Lozinska) Senchyna (who came from Ukraine) and educated in Remsen school houses. Anne was raised in a large hardworking family and those values were instilled in her at a young age. From 1943 until 1944 Anne was employed with Rome Area Depot (now Griffiss Airforce Base) as Rosie the Riveter. Rosie the Riveter is a cultural icon in the US which represented the women who worked in factories and shipyards during WWII, many of whom produced munitions and war supplies and worked on military planes such as the B-52 Bomber. These women sometimes took entirely new jobs replacing the male workers who joined the military. Rosie is widely recognized by the “We Can Do It” slogan. Anne had to leave this job to take care of her ill mother. In 1948, she was united in marriage with Laurence Dupont. He passed away July 14, 2004. Mr. and Mrs. Dupont were longtime area farmers. They ran a farm in the Town of Russia, then the Zoller Farm in Newville, and finally the Col. Teal Farm in Newport. Mrs. Dupont loved watching birds, cooking, her cats and enjoyed mowing her 3-acre lawn which she did until the age of 97.
